Hong Kong’s CineAsia conference, which focuses on exhibition and distribution, closed last night with the customary prize ceremony at which most everyone knows what they’ve won before the starters are served.

The conference sessions provided attendees with an early look at James Cameron’s 3D conversion of Titanic. 18 minutes were screened during a presentation by producer Jon Landau. The film releases 6 April next year, just ahead of the 15 April centenary of the unsinkable ship’s demise on its maiden voyage.
